>The strange thing is, that the size of the new file (frx) is not the same, as for the actual report... Memo file has the same size.
The odds are that the .FRX in question was created under a different version of VFP, so the DBF header format used is an older format; the header format would only be changed if the file's structure changed, or if it were copied using a different version. You can see the same effect; create a report under VFP6, and then try:
CREATE REPORT blah
USE blah.FRX
COPY TO woof.FRX TYPE FOX2X
